AI synthesisDonald Trump has publicly criticized the United States' financial and defense commitments to NATO, labeling the relationship as "one-sided" and "ridiculous." These remarks were made less than a week before a scheduled NATO summit in Ankara, where the alliance's future and member contributions are expected to be key discussion points.
